![]() |
|
|
Google unix.com
|
|||||||
| Foren | Registrieren | Forum-Regeln | Links | Alben | FAQ | Benutzerliste | Kalender | Suche | Die heutige Beiträge | Alle Foren als gelesen markieren |
| Shell Programmierung und Scripting Post Fragen zu ksh, csh, sh, bash, Perl, PHP, sed, awk und anderen Shell-Skripte und Shell-Scripting-Sprachen hier. |
Mehr UNIX-und Linux-Forum Themen Vielleicht finden Sie hilfreiche
|
||||
| Faden | Thread Starter | Forum | Antworten | Last Post |
| sed-Abfrage | gopsman | Shell Programmierung und Scripting | 4 | 02-03-2009 02:41 AM |
| Und in SQL-Abfrage | Lindarella | Shell Programmierung und Scripting | 3 | 10-09-2006 05:43 PM |
| Abfrage in awk | raguramtgr | UNIX for Dummies Questions & Answers | 1 | 08-27-2004 12:00 PM |
| RPM-Abfrage | silvaman | UNIX für Fortgeschrittene und Experten | 1 | 08-15-2003 08:56 AM |
|
|
LinkBack | Thread Tools | Suche diesen Thread | Rate Thread | Anzeige-Modi |
|
||||
|
sed-Abfrage
Ich habe eine Reihe von Ordnern / temp / a / temp / b / temp / c
In Ordner A, B, und C, ich habe Dateien a1.txt ... ... .... a20.txt b1.txt ... ... .... b40.txt & c1.txt ... ... .... c60.txt Jede Datei hat die gleichen Daten-Format: -- Linie 1 AAAAA aaaa Linie 2 BBB bbbbbb Linie 3 CCCC cccccc Etc etc Ich brauche an, um einen sed Skript, das auf alle Dateien und die Daten somit neu: -- Linie 1 AAAAA aaaa Linie 2 BBB Line 3 X bbbbbb Linie 4 CCCC cccccc Etc etc Also ich brauche, um eine CR / LF in Zeile 2 Position 4, Erstellen Sie eine neue Linie 3 mit einer konstanten Text (X) und den Wert dessen, was auf der rechten Seite der früheren Linie 2 (bbbbbb) und bewegen Sie die restlichen Zeilen eine Zeile nach unten. Kann mir jemand bitte helfen? Ich weiß nicht, sed sehr gut, und awk gar nicht. |
| Lesezeichen |
| Thread Tools | Suche diesen Thread |
| Anzeige-Modi | Rate this thread |
|
|